Canada’s Economy Contracts for a Second Straight Quarter
Canada’s economy has unexpectedly contracted for a second consecutive quarter, raising the likelihood of a technical recession as the country grapples with stalled economic activity and tariff uncertainties. This decline, marked by a 0.1% annualized decrease in GDP, comes as a surprise to economists who had anticipated growth.

American Households Face Increased Energy Costs Amid Ongoing Conflict
Recent data indicates that American households are experiencing an average increase of nearly $450 in energy expenses, largely due to the ongoing conflict in Iran affecting energy prices. This financial strain is prompting concerns about the overall economic impact on households across the country as many consumers are forced to dip into savings or incur additional debt.
EU’s Economic Powers Strike Deal to Push Capital Markets Merger
The European Union’s six largest economies have reached an agreement to implement a bloc-wide capital markets union, a significant step aimed at enhancing economic integration and spurring action after years of delay. This initiative is expected to bolster investment and economic growth across the region, reflecting a strategic shift towards deeper financial collaboration among EU member states.
